2014 Round Top Summer Music Festival: Texas Festival Orchestra with conductor Charles Olivieri-Munroe

eventdetail
Round Top Festival Institute

Founded 44 years ago by concert pianist James Dick, the Round Top Festival Institute annually selects 95 students (from over 500 applicants) who study with master faculty and perform in the Texas Festival Orchestra.

On the program are Antonín Dvořák's Scherzo capriccioso, Tchaikovsky's Concerto for Violin and Orchestra with soloist Stefan Milenkovich and Tchaikovsky's Symphony No. 4.
